> Do you (or anyone else on the list) know if FreeType's 26.6 format pixel
> use the same orientation as typical screen graphics (+X = right, +Y =
> down) or normal Cartesian coordinates (+X = right, Y+ = up)?
> 

Taken from the "FreeType Glyph Conventions" document:

  "The grid is always oriented like the traditional
   mathematical two-dimensional plane, i.e., the X axis
   from the left to the right, and the Y axis from
   bottom to top."

so these are cartesian coordinates..
